2009-01-09 50 views

回答

1

我怀疑这会奏效。 System.ServiceModel驻留在GAC中。它还有一些其他的3.0程序集,如Microsoft.Transactions.Bridge,System.IdentityModel等。谁知道它还可能依赖于注册表中的其他非显而易见的东西。

固件3.0也不适用于Windows 2000,您可以尝试安装,但是否能正常工作是另一个问题(请参阅:http://msdn.microsoft.com/en-us/library/aa480198.aspx中的要求部分)。如果你成功了,但事情进一步破裂,那么安装将不受MS支持。

最好的办法是为自己节约一个痛苦的世界,并在兼容的环境(XP SP2/Windows 2003-SP1或更高版本)上安装FW 3.0并将其作为目标。

0

可能工作,但我会一直主张为您的应用程序安装适当的框架版本。这样你就会知道你在做什么*支持/支持

*至少在部署方面 - 代码是另一回事。

0

它是否会起作用是无关紧要的。这当然不聪明。即使它有效,也可能有一种情况只发生在需要3.0框架的x次中的一次。这将很难调试,并且在你的开发箱上完全无法再现。